Siemens and B2C2 Adopt JPMorgan’s Blockchain FX Network for 24/7 Settlements

Industrial conglomerate Siemens AG and crypto market maker B2C2 have integrated JPMorgan Chase's blockchain-based foreign exchange platform, enabling near-instant cross-border settlements in major fiat currencies. The system bypasses traditional banking hours, offering continuous transaction capabilities that prove critical during crypto market volatility.

B2C2 CEO Thomas Restout highlights the operational advantage: 'Round-the-clock cash movement lets us manage weekend margin calls that previously left traders stranded.' The platform processes $3 billion daily through JPMorgan's Onyx Digital Payments network, marking growing institutional adoption of blockchain infrastructure for treasury operations.
